Seite sperren und Fehlerseite ausgeben, eine IP erlauben..

Alles, was den Apache betrifft, kann hier besprochen werden.

Seite sperren und Fehlerseite ausgeben, eine IP erlauben..

Postby Dirty Harry » 19. February 2021 20:26

Hallo

Wie kann ich mit .htaccess die Seite für alle inkl. Robots sperren und eine Fehlerseite ausgeben z.B. das die Seite sich im Aufbau befindet, aber eine IP erlauben die Seite zu sehen?

Das funktioniert:
Code: Select all
Order deny,allow
Deny from all
Allow from 999.999.999.99


Nur wie gebe ich noch eine selbstgebaute Fehlerseite für die die nicht auf die Seite können aus?
Dirty Harry
 
Posts: 21
Joined: 16. January 2021 14:33
XAMPP version: 3.2.4
Operating System: Windows

Re: Seite sperren und Fehlerseite ausgeben, eine IP erlauben

Postby Nobbie » 20. February 2021 10:04

Mit ErrorDocument 403 (und/oder 404) eine eigene Fehlerseite definieren. Diese Fehlerseite sollte in einem separaten Ordner stehen, sonst hast Du ggf. ein Huhn und Ei Problem.

https://httpd.apache.org/docs/2.4/custom-error.html
Nobbie
 
Posts: 13170
Joined: 09. March 2008 13:04

Re: Seite sperren und Fehlerseite ausgeben, eine IP erlauben

Postby Dirty Harry » 20. February 2021 14:14

Das funktioniert nicht, sobald der deny in der htaccess drin ist, nimmt er nichts weiter mehr aus dieser an bzw. es werden sämtliche weitere Einträge ignoriert.
Dirty Harry
 
Posts: 21
Joined: 16. January 2021 14:33
XAMPP version: 3.2.4
Operating System: Windows

Re: Seite sperren und Fehlerseite ausgeben, eine IP erlauben

Postby Nobbie » 21. February 2021 12:54

Das funktioniert einwandfrei, ich würde ziemlich sicher vermuten, dass Du genau diesen einen Fehler machst, auf den ich explizit hingewiesen habe (s.o.). Wie sieht denn die .htaccess jetzt aus, wie sieht das ErrorDocument aus und wo ist es gespeichert?
Nobbie
 
Posts: 13170
Joined: 09. March 2008 13:04


Return to Apache

Who is online

Users browsing this forum: No registered users and 20 guests